The contact owns a 2010 Toyota Corolla equipped with Michelin greenx defender (na) tires, size: 195/65/R15 (na). While driving 55 mph, the rear driver's side tire blew out. The vehicle spun around and was struck by a box truck. The contact was not injured. A police report was filed. The contact was able to drive away from the scene of the crash. The dealer was not contacted. The manufacturer was not contacted. The tire was replaced. The tire was a replacement tire. The tire failure mileage was 3,000 and the vehicle failure mileage was 75,000.
